Guidebook on Community Disaster Preparedness


As part of the NGODPP, this guidebook is produced to provide practical guidelines and tools to local organizations on designing and implementing community-led disaster risk reduction and preparedness programs. The contents are collected from various sources including those from IIRR. The target users of this book are local community-based organizations and national non-profit organizations in Asia. It features easy to understand language and offers more practical tools and steps to help target users facilitate community-led disaster preparedness.
